Age restrictions are in place for some body piercings, but generally not for ear piercing.
Yes, but make sure it’s carried out by an experienced ear-piercing professional. If you have allergies or if you suffer from eczema or dermatitis, ask for your ears to be pierced with jewelry that is nickel-free.
You can avoid subsequent infections and hole closures by leaving your earrings in for at least six weeks after your initial piercing. Remove an earring earlier, and the pierced hole may close over. You should also be strict on hygiene after you’ve had your ears pierced: wash your hands before touching your ears, clean and rinse your piercings with salt water or a mild, fragrance-free soap and water at least once a day, and apply a thin layer of petroleum jelly around each opening. If in doubt, your piercing technician should be able to advise you on how to take care of your newly pierced ears.
Yes. Sleeping with your ears newly pierced shouldn’t be a problem.
Whichever you’d prefer. A piercing gun is instant and the fastest way to pierce your ears. Needle piercings are a three-stage process, but are thought to allow for a more precise piercing, are less traumatic for your ear tissue, and can be more hygienic.
